Contents Definition[edit] "Demographers tend to define infertility as childlessness in a population of women of reproductive age," whereas "the epidemiological definition refers to "trying for" or "time to" a pregnancy, generally in a population of women exposed to" a probability of conception.[8] Currently, female fertility normally peaks at age 24 and diminishes after 30, with pregnancy occurring rarely after age 50.[9] A female is most fertile within 24 hours of ovulation.[9] Male fertility peaks usually at age 25 and declines after age 40.[9] The time needed to pass (during which the couple tries to conceive) for that couple to be diagnosed with infertility differs between different jurisdictions.

ART: Gamete Intrafallopian Transfer (GIFT) GIFT is a procedure that involves ovarian stimulation, egg retrieval, and placing a mixture of sperm and eggs directly into the woman’s fallopian tube to foster fertilization inside the female body. It is increasingly recognized that egg quality is of critical importance and women of advanced maternal age have eggs of reduced capacity for normal and successful fertilization.

Assessment of ovarian reserve This is a very important assessment of a woman's remaining egg supply It is done with blood testing and ultrasound: Blood - day 3 FSH, LH and estradiol hormone testing and AMH hormone levels Ultrasound - assessment of ovarian volume and antral follicle counts Assessment of adequate ovulation This can be done in a variety of ways.
